Bunraku (puppet theatre) did not originate in Osaka, but was popularised here. The most famous bunraku playwright, Chikametsu Monzaemon (1653-1724), wrote plays set in Osaka concerning the lives of merchants and other regular folk normally ignored by traditional Japanese drama. Bunraku became a favourite art form and this theatre seeks to revive its popularity.

Performances are only held at certain times of the year: check with the tourist information offices.
